Handover note — Crumbwheel order cutoffs.

Welcome aboard. The bakery cutoff rule in Crumbwheel closes same-day orders at 14:00 local to each storefront, not UTC — this has bitten us twice. Holiday overrides live in the calendar service and take precedence silently, so always check there first when a cutoff looks wrong. To unlock the calendar service's admin console after a restart, enter the recovery passphrase below.

vault phrase of bagap-bahaf = silion-pelox-sorox-casdor-quenwyn-fraax-eliox-praael-kelion-quenvan-kasox-rusael-norius-belvan

Finance Review Summary — Sales Leads

Q3 close includes an inventory write-down on the Torvex line, driven by slow turnover at the Aldmere warehouse and a component revision that made two SKUs obsolete. Net impact lands within the revised forecast shared in September. Remaining Torvex stock will be discounted through approved channels only; do not improvise pricing. Margin targets for Q4 are unchanged, though mix will shift toward the Bramwick range. Expect updated quota sheets next week. One further point for your awareness follows.

management briefing: Project Ulavan slips by two quarters because of the staffing delay.

## Runbook: ProfileVault shard split (phase 2)

Quick heads-up for security review: we're splitting the user-profile store into four shards keyed on account hash. The migration job runs under the `shardmover` service account, read-only on the source until cutover. Rollback is just flipping the router config back, no data moves. All writes during the window go through the dual-write proxy, so nothing should be lost if we abort. The cutover manifest must be signed before the deploy gate will accept it, using the key below.

deploy key for kajof-fajop: bky6_gDHw9Q

# Who to ping: Pebblecrest Firmware Channel

Hey future maintainers — the OTA update channel for Pebblecrest devices is owned by the Device Experience crew. If a rollout stalls or the staging ring looks weird, don't fiddle with the promotion flags yourself; that's bitten us twice. The crew triages requests daily and is pretty responsive. Drop a note with your device model and channel name to the address below.

escalation mailbox, bafog-fafog: ulador@paliqlabs.internal